Derek McInnes
“The better team won.
“The first goal comes out of nothing. We should be dealing with it far better, from the first ball up. It is a mistake from big Joe which we are not going to criticise too much because he has been outstanding since he has been with us. I said last week that he has been flawless. He could have done better with one or two of the goals but the intent and aggression from the Motherwell team was far better than ours to be honest.
“We knew what to expect.
“They engage with their strikers. If they don’t win the first ball they are quick to support the second one. They get the ball wide, they get crosses into the box. A lot of their game is very simplistic but it got the job done.
“My players want to win but the team with the greater intent and aggression to their play won tonight. They maybe got a bit of fortune with the first goal but other than that they were the better team and thoroughly deserved to get through.
“I thought in general, between both boxes at times we did some decent things. In the second half we were better. We had a couple of chances in the first half but I thought they defended better throughout. As I say their intent and aggression was better than ours and sometimes that can make all the difference.

“It is our first defeat of the season and defeats come in many different ways.
“You can be outplayed and you can be outfought. I thought at times, even though we knew what to expect and we knew what we were facing, we did not deal with it.
“Motherwell are good at what they do. I think Motherwell will do very well this season and they had the best player on the park. Moult is on the move all the time, he spooks defenders, his work rate and aggression sets the tone for the team. They are not a one-man team, of course they are not, but he is such a big player for them. He gets the first goal and in the final minutes is still running hard to get his second goal. He was the best player on the park but a long way today.
“A lot of our players huffed and puffed and they were trying, there was no lack of effort or will but for me we needed to a bit more aggression and intent to our play.
“3-0 was maybe a bit harsh but there is no doubt we deserved to lose the game.
